What are the responsibilities and job description for the Head Custodian position at East Greenwich School Department?
The East Greenwich School Department seeks applications for three Head Custodians to work in our school buildings.
The Head Custodian keeps the school building in such a state of operating excellence that the buildings present no problems or interruptions to the educational program. The Head Custodian creates and follows a complex schedule for the performance of custodial duties. The Head Custodian is required to maintain assigned areas and equipment in a clean, orderly and secure manner. The Head Custodian does special cleaning and semi-skilled building maintenance periodically and performs routine specialized cleaning tasks during periods of student recess. The Head Custodian facilitates any and all other duties as assigned by administration necessary for school operation. The Head Custodian is given a yearly stipend starting from $1664-2392, depending on which school the position is located.
Performs all of the duties of the custodian.
Supervises school custodian (s).
Effectively utilizes district technologies appropriate to the position and assumes responsibility for attending district training needed to successfully perform designated responsibilities as directed by supervisor.
Maintains regular attendance.
Performs minor maintenance and repairs, (plumbing, electrical, painting) in building.
Immediately reports any vandalism or other damage to school property to his/her superior.
Assumes responsibility for the security of the building-all doors and windows locked and lights turned off as needed.
Maintains an inventory of supplies and equipment and places orders in advance so as not to hinder the continued performance of building custodial duties.
Complies with District Policies.
Assists in special events presentations and preparations
Corrects minor safety hazards when observed and/or immediately refers major safety hazards to School Principals.
Monitors the work of custodial staff, ensures that the building remains clean and in good repair.
Performs other related tasks as assigned or required, such as attending school crossing, if necessary.
Secures additional staffing for events or overtime opportunities as deemed appropriate per the contract.
